You will join our Central Europe Purchasing team in our Plant in Gliwice, Poland. Your main missions will include:
- Supporting plants in detecting supply chain risks and implementing countermeasures to prevent disruption of supply
- Managing supply stop, contract termination, insourcing and outsourcing
- Identifying cost savings opportunities and implementing these with suppliers and plants
- Implementing engineering changes in serial life
- Ensuring correct payment of suppliers
- Managing mandated parts and suppliers
- Productivity, on-time deliveries, right first-time invoices, sourcing in compliance with target
Your main activities will be:
- Leads each time necessary the problem-solving process (management of operative supply bottlenecks)
- Manages and negotiates requests for price increases <20k€ per year (>20k€ Commodity Buyer)
- Secures supplier payment process, Invoice approval
- Manages supplier relocation in serial phase
- Identifies savings opportunities with plants & promotes technical savings proposed by suppliers
- Prepares and presents Pre-RFQ & Sourcing in serial production phase
- Prepares and implements Nomination Letter in Serial Production
- Manages excess material between suppliers and plants
- Follows and reports the suppliers operative performance, defines and implements improvement plans
- Is responsible for suppliers performance in terms of quality, cost and timing within his/her country perimeter
- Ensures proper handover of purchasing responsibilities from program to serial phase for each project
- Supports the commodity buyers on:
-
- solving Recurring bottleneck/crisis (e.g. major force majeure)
- managing suppliers' tool damages and repair
- managing supplier insolvencies
- benchmarking activities

VIE – as part of the reinforcement program of youth employability, Business France created the VIE Contract for young European. To be eligible to the program, one must be between the age of 18 to 28 years old, have European citizenship and have never worked in the country where they apply to.
